A life with passionate love or one that brings easement? That is the ensuing choice Geoffrey Jones must make. Thirty year old software developer, Geoff Jones, has endured his fair share of heartbreak, making a promise to himself to revisit love only when his career is fully advanced. His practical ideals and desire for success has him locked and focus... that is until he meets an unexpected person who changes all his plans. Enter Joe. Disheveled and rugged, Joe has recently left an unhappy marriage. After ten years wasted in a loveless union and burn out as a legal assistant, Joe makes a hasty move back to his childhood Philadelphia. When he is offered a new job as an entry level cloud developer at PNC, Joe takes the opportunity to redirect his life. Although love is the last thing on Joe's mind after his divorce, chemistry arises between him and his new mentor, Geoff. Launch yourself into an intense and heart wrenching story that features two broken souls who rediscover the meaning of love.
